2023年2月
网络上很多关于JS原型的理解,写了很多,我也看了很多,但总是云里雾里,很多文章一上来就说Object是一切对象的根对象,这句话非常误导人的思维,后来自己在控制台,自己分析出来了比较好理解的方...
JS执行机制 1、先执行执行栈中的同步任务 2、异步任务(回调函数)放入任务队列中 3、一旦执行栈中的所有同步任务执行完毕,系统就会按顺序读取任务队列中的异步任务,于是被读取的异步任务结束...
每日算法 今日是: 1、将字符串转换为驼峰格式 2、判断字符串中是否有连续重复的字符 将字符串转换成驼峰格式 // css 中经常有类似 background-image 这种通过 ...
我们知道,用户体验是 Web 产品最为重要的部分。尽可能减少首屏加载时间,更为流畅地展示用户所需求的内容,会是用户是否留存的关键因素。 而随着现代 Web 业务可供用户的交互行为越来越多,...
一、所需的地形文件和模型以及 CesiumJs 包 操作之前,我们需要两份对应的文件,一份是地形文件(可无),一份是对应的模型文件,本次展示的模型是转换成了 3Dtiles 类型的。 ...
先上结论: 防抖 :只执行最后一次 (常用语输入框) 节流: 控制执行的次数 (常下拉滚动条时进行数据请求) 防抖代码 : (这是未封装的,防抖代码和业务代...
安装nvm、node、npm
下载nvm安装包,推荐使用1.1.7,我个人使用1.1.8会有中文乱码的报错
点击exe文件,注意修改nvm的安装根目录以及node的安装根目录,后者是以...
问题 ios设备:点击input,软键盘弹出,页面整体向上偏移 需求 当软键盘弹起,input改变位置并始终贴着软键盘,整体页面不上移动 解决 页面采用flex布局 < ...
需求 实现sum函数,使其可以传入不定长参数,以及不定次数调用 //示例
console.log(sum(1,2)(3)()) //6
console.log(sum(2,3,4,5)...
在 事件循环 期间的某个时刻,运行时会从最先进入队列的消息开始处理队列中的消息。被处理的消息会被移出队列,并作为输入参数来调用与之关联的函数。正如前面所提到的,调用一个函数总...
首先要知道JavaScript是使用 垃圾回收的语言 ,它会每隔一段时间就会释放内存进行闲置资源回收。像函数中的局部变量,函数执行时在内部使用了变量,栈内存会分配空间...
要了解内存泄漏与内存溢出,首先需要了解内存是怎么分配的,故此,本文将按照以下几节阐述:
内存管理
垃圾回收·
内存泄漏
内存管理 JavaScript 是在创建变量(对象,...
函子(Functor) 函子是一个特殊的容器,通过一个普通对象来实现,该对象具有 map 方法, map 方法可以运行一个函数对值进行处理(变形关系), 容器 包含值和值变形关系(这个变形关系...
01,如何开启JS严格模式?JS严格模式有什么特点? 两种方式 全局开启在js开头加上 'use strict' 局部开启,在作用域开头加上 function fn (...
题目描述:判断字符串中重复次数最多的字符 // 解决思路: // 1.判断字符重复的方法 // 创建空数组,利用键值对形式对每个字符进行计数 // 用到 采用for循环结合if判断 ...
一、同源政策
跨域问题其实就是浏览器的同源策略造成的。同源策略限制了从同一个源加载的文档或脚本如何与另一个源的资源进行交互。这是浏览器的一个用于隔离潜在恶意文件的重要的安全机制。同源指的是...
好家伙,JS基础接着学, 1.事件流 页面哪个部分拥有特定的事件? 可以把页面想象成一个同心圆, 当你戳了其中的一点, 其实你同...
原博客地址 01. 如何开启js严格模式?js严格模式有什么特点? 参考点: js基础知识 参考答案: // 全局开启
'use stcict'
// 局部开启
funct...
熟悉一个新项目一般都是如下步骤: git clone xxxnpm installnpm run dev或者 git clone xxxyarnyarn start yarn是什么?yar...
首先 在类中的方法中。this 要看是谁调用的。如果是实例调用的,那么这个this就是这个实例。如: class Student {
constructor(flag) { ...
这里给大家分享我在网上总结出来的一些知识,希望对大家有所帮助 从webview页面传值到uniapp中 官方文档已经很详细了,这里给大家上我的实战代码,首先在webview页面中...
javascript编程单线程之同步模式 主流的 js 环境都是单线程吗模式执行js 代码, js 采用为单线程的原因与最开始设计初衷有关,最早是运行在浏览器端的脚本语言,目的是为了实现页...
01、如何判断⼀个变量是不是数组? let arr = [ 1, 2, 3, 4]
function fun (){
return arr instanceof Array...
01、描述事件冒泡的流程 基于 DOM 树结构,事件会顺着触发元素向上冒泡 点击一个div,会一级一级向父级、爷级元素上冒泡,这个点击事件不仅能被这个div捕捉到,也能被他的父级、爷爷级…元...
匹配输入的字符:以字母或_开头,后面由数字字母_组成长度为5-20的字符串 var reg=/^[a-bA-B_][a-bA-B0-9_]{4,19}/
var name1='abb...
- « 前一页
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- ...
- 223
- 后一页 »